Pozzilli is a center of the Molise.
To know
It is of great importance at the provincial level thanks to the presence in its municipal territory of most of the factories of the industrial core of Venafro-Pozzilli.
Geographical notes
It is located in theMolise Apennines in the Volturno valley, between the Mainarde mountain range to the northeast and the Matese massif to the southeast, in an alluvial plateau of streams such as La Rava and Ravigone. The territory includes pine and oak forests, while the surrounding hills are covered with vineyards and olive groves. From the hills of Pozzilli you can clearly see Capriati a Volturno and Prata Sannita to the east and along the middle Volturno valley you can see to the southeast Sesto Campano, to the right, and further away, Vairano Patenora, to the left. It borders on Venafro to whose municipal territory it belonged for a long time. Until 1860 with Sesto Campano, Venafro is Conca Casale was part of Land of Work in the Kingdom of the Two Sicilies.
Background
Until 1810 its history is part of that of Venafro of which Pozzilli was a hamlet. The remains found testify to human presence in prehistoric times. In the locality of Camerelle, near the railway level crossing, a Samnite necropolis was found in the seventies. In Roman times the territory was crossed by the Roman aqueduct of Venafro. At the end of the 18th century it was found there in the Triverno area Aquarium table, an epigraph dated to 26 BC. under Augustus, who reported the rules for the maintenance of the aqueduct and the distribution of its waters.
The municipal territory belonged to the Lombard Duchy of Benevento. The fraction of Santa Maria Oliveto it would have been founded in 839 by settlers from the area of Sulmona that were settled there by the abbey of San Vincenzo al Volturno around a church dedicated to San Lorenzo. In Norman times in the locality of "Arcora", at the foot of Mount Stingone, east of the municipal capital, one of the small Benedictine settlements was built. marked the path between the great abbeys of Monte Cassino and of San Vincenzo al Volturno: there are preserved some arches of an ancient building that gave the place its name.
The municipal territory belonged in 1234 to the feudal lord Ruggiero Galluccio who was subsequently usurped by a certain Gualtiero D'Aversa. In the 16th century it was in the possession of the Pandone di Venafro family, and then passed to the Gaetani. In the seventeenth century its name entered history as a papal bull of Innocent X of 1646 wrote of Pozzilli ("Li pozzilli"). In 1811 the district of Piedimonte d'Alife was established, into which the district of Venafro fell. and the territory of Colli detached from the district of Sora. Up to this date Pozzilli was a fraction of the municipality of Venafro (which was also the district seat) together with Filignano, Conca Casale, Ceppagna is Sesto Campano (Venafro and reunited). With the Garibaldi occupation and the annexation to the Kingdom of Sardinia in 1860 the district of Piedimonte and the district of Venafro were suppressed.
Santa Maria Oliveto instead was in its own right, "possession" of Monte Cassino, and passed to the municipality of Pozzilli as a fraction only shortly before the unification of Italy with the royal decree of Ferdinand II of Naples, King of the Two Sicilies.
During the Second World War, between the autumn of 1943 and the spring of 1944, the territory of Pozzilli was the scene of fierce fighting between the Germans barricaded on the mountains north-west of the Volturno river and the Allies deployed to the south-east, along the left bank of the river, suffering damage in particular from German reprisals.After the post-war reconstruction, in the sixties and seventies it suffered a significant decrease in population due to emigration abroad and in Northern Italy. The phenomenon has reversed since the 1980s following the installation of industries in the area ("Industrial nucleus of Pozzilli and Venafro", which includes, among others, a non-food branch of Unilever and Lavazza) or a short distance away (Cassino) . In the spring of 1984 it suffered damage from the earthquake with its epicenter in the Comino Valley (FR).
Since 1994, together with other 338 partners, he has been part ofNational Association of Oil Cities.

What see
- Medieval village of Santa Maria Oliveto. This village is of very ancient origins and its construction dates back to around the year one thousand. As evidence of this, it is possible to note how the ancient village is surrounded by walls and thirteen defensive towers. Even today what remains of the small castle is visible and to the east there is the small city gate called "Portella" by the inhabitants. In the locality of Santa Lucia there are still remains of the Augustan aqueduct that from the sources of the Volturno near Rocchetta channeled the water for Venafro. Inside the village in piazza Seggio there is the small church of San Lorenzo Martire, patron saint of the town. In the church it is possible to visit the medieval apse representing the twelve apostles with Jesus, some frescoes of little value and the precious wooden statue of San Lorenzo made from walnut wood.
- 1 Parish Church of Santa Caterina d'Alessandria. The church was built in the 14th century but remodeled in the 16th. The baroque facade is in pink plaster with some frames. The small bell tower is a tower. The interior with a single nave preserves a precious canvas depicting the mystical wedding of Saint Catherine, painted from the 16th century: a saint is placed on the left and receives a laurel wreath from the enthroned Madonna.
